About the Artist

Gesner Armand

Born in Croix-des-Bouquets, Gesner Armand trained at the Centre d'Art in Port-au-Prince and continued his studies in Paris. A poet-painter at heart, he balanced European technique with Haitian lyricism. His canvases blossom with flowers, birds, angels, musicians, and carnival processions rendered in radiant blues and oranges. Armand's brush sings: petals become rhythm, angels become dancers, color becomes chorus. He was also curator of the Musée d'Art Haïtien, where he championed fellow Haitian artists and preserved the country's artistic patrimony. Through his long career, Armand captured Haiti's inner music—a visual symphony of devotion and delight. He died in 2008.
